Journal of Physical Chemistry, Vol.99, No.1, 8-10, 1995
Copolymer of Pyridine and Indigo - A Pi-Conjugated Polymer with Color-Center
pi-Conjugated copolymers constituted of poly(pyridine-2,5-diyl) (PPy) and indigo-6,6’-diyl units exhibits pi-pi* absorption bands at 370 and 645 nm originating from the PPy and indigo chromophores, respectively. They take a Linear structure with a large degree of depolarization (rho(v) = 0.19-0.33), and stretching of a poly(vinyl alcohol) film containing the copolymer gives a film which exhibits large (15-20) and medium (2-3) dichroic ratios for the PPy and indigo chromophores, respectively, due to the alignment of the polymer molecules along the direction of the stretching.
